Common Welding Inspection Methods



A range of evaluation methods are used to examine the top quality and integrity of welds, each customized to find specific kinds of problems. Amongst the most typical methods is aesthetic evaluation, which includes a thorough assessment of the weld surface area to identify visible problems such as splits, damages, and poor blend. This technique is commonly the very first step in the evaluation process due to its simpleness and cost-effectiveness.


One more extensively utilized method is radiographic inspection, where X-rays or gamma rays pass through the weld to disclose inner issues. This strategy is particularly efficient for identifying porosity and additions within the weld material. Ultrasonic screening uses high-frequency audio waves to recognize interior defects, supplying a comprehensive analysis of the weld's stability.


Moreover, magnetic bit examination is made use of for ferromagnetic materials, enabling the discovery of surface and near-surface defects by using electromagnetic fields and observing bit patterns. Color penetrant testing entails using a fluid dye to the weld surface area, disclosing cracks and various other stoppages upon evaluation (Welding Inspection Milwaukee). Each of these methods plays a critical role in making sure weld quality and conformity with sector standards


Non-Destructive Checking Strategies



Non-destructive screening (NDT) strategies are necessary devices in the assessment of weld high quality, allowing inspectors to examine the integrity of bonded joints without triggering damages to the materials. Different NDT approaches are employed to identify possible flaws, ensuring that welds fulfill the called for standards for safety and security and performance.


Among the most widespread strategies is ultrasonic testing (UT), which uses high-frequency audio waves to find interior problems moved here such as cracks or gaps. Radiographic screening (RT) uses X-rays or gamma rays to produce pictures of welds, revealing any type of suspensions within the material. Magnetic fragment testing (MT) works for discovering surface area and near-surface defects in ferromagnetic products through the application of electromagnetic fields and contrasting fragments.


Liquid penetrant screening (PT) is an additional extensively utilized approach that involves applying a dye to the surface of the weld, which permeates into any cracks, making them visible under ultraviolet light. Each of these approaches supplies unique advantages and restrictions, and the option of an appropriate strategy is vital to achieving exact analyses of weld integrity. Ultimately, the execution of NDT techniques dramatically adds to the reliability and security of design applications.
